Courmayeur is one of the most famous and prestigious ski resorts in the Italian Alps. Here you can enjoy skiing while surrounded by stunning alpine scenery.

Cortina D’Ampezzo is a resort with a rich history and excellent ski conditions. It is popular among experienced skiers and snowboarders due to its steep slopes and trails of the highest difficulty category.

Alta Badia is a cozy resort that is part of the Dolomiti Superski area, one of the largest ski areas in the world.

Selva Val Gardena offers a variety of trails, from easy ones for beginners to challenging ones for experienced athletes.

Madonna di Campiglio is a resort popular with families and those who value the comfort of vacationers. It is famous for its well-prepared trails and modern infrastructure.

Livigno is one of the largest ski resorts in the Italian Alps.

Cervinia is a resort located on the border of Italy and Switzerland, which makes it especially attractive to international tourists.

Passo Tonale is an excellent choice for those who value variety and convenience. The resort offers excellent skiing and snowboarding opportunities, as well as excellent conditions for beginners.

Latzerai and Monte Bondone are two resorts combined into one ski area.

Val di Fassa is a resort known for its cozy mountain villages, traditional atmosphere and varied ski slopes.
